WBGO DJ Kicks Off Free Summer Concert Series

Legendary WBGO radio personality Felix Hernandez will bring his famous Rhythm Revue Dance Party to NJPAC’s Chambers Plaza on June 27, 2025, launching the annual Horizon Sounds of the City free outdoor concert series as part of the North 2 Shore Festival. The event promises an evening of classic soul and R&B that transforms downtown Newark into a community celebration.

The free, open-air dance party represents the festival’s commitment to accessible cultural programming while highlighting the rich musical heritage of New Jersey’s largest city through one of its most beloved radio personalities.

Radio Legend Brings Dance Party to Downtown Newark

Felix Hernandez, long established as one of the Northeast’s premier soul and R&B authorities through his WBGO radio program, will transform Chambers Plaza into a vibrant outdoor dance floor with his signature mix of classic tracks from artists including James Brown, Aretha Franklin, and Marvin Gaye. The event continues Hernandez’s tradition of creating communal experiences through carefully curated musical selections that span decades of soul, funk, and R&B history.

“Felix doesn’t just play records—he creates an atmosphere where everyone feels connected through the music,” said NJPAC President John Schreiber. “His encyclopedic knowledge combined with his innate understanding of what makes people dance has made the Rhythm Revue an institution in this region for decades.”

According to North 2 Shore Festival organizers, the event will feature Hernandez’s renowned selection of classic tracks while creating a “festival atmosphere” that welcomes attendees of all ages and backgrounds to participate in this communal celebration of soul music’s enduring legacy.

NJPAC’s Free Outdoor Series Enhances Urban Experience

The Rhythm Revue Dance Party kicks off NJPAC’s popular Horizon Sounds of the City series, which has become a summertime tradition in Newark. The free outdoor concert series transforms Chambers Plaza into a vibrant community gathering space where residents and visitors alike can experience high-quality performances in an accessible, welcoming environment.

“These free events represent the heart of NJPAC’s mission to make the arts accessible to everyone,” explained Sarah Thompson, NJPAC’s Director of Community Engagement. “The Horizon Sounds of the City series brings together people from all walks of life, creating these beautiful moments where the entire neighborhood comes together through music.”

The plaza, located at 1 Center Street adjacent to NJPAC’s main building, will feature local food and beverage vendors during the event, enhancing the community festival atmosphere while supporting local businesses. The convenient downtown location makes the event accessible via public transportation, with parking available in nearby lots for those traveling from further distances.

North 2 Shore Festival Emphasizes Community Access

Felix Hernandez’s performance represents the inclusive spirit of the broader North 2 Shore Festival, which runs from June 14-29 across Asbury Park, Newark, and Atlantic City. According to New Jersey Stage, the multi-city celebration includes over 300 events ranging from major concert performances to community-based arts programming.

The festival, conceived by Governor Phil Murphy and First Lady Tammy Murphy, aims to showcase New Jersey’s artistic diversity while ensuring programming remains accessible to all residents. This commitment to accessibility is particularly evident in Newark’s programming, which features numerous free events in public spaces throughout the city.

“Events like the Rhythm Revue Dance Party are central to our mission of creating cultural experiences that truly reflect the communities we serve,” noted festival director Maria Rodriguez. “Felix has this remarkable ability to bring people together through music in a way that celebrates Newark’s rich cultural heritage while creating new shared memories.”

Event Details and Additional Information

The Felix Hernandez Rhythm Revue Dance Party begins at 5:00 PM on Friday, June 27, in Chambers Plaza at NJPAC. The event is free and open to the public with no tickets required, though early arrival is recommended for those wanting prime dancing space near the stage.

Attendees are encouraged to bring lawn chairs or blankets for seating, though much of the crowd typically remains standing for dancing throughout the evening. The event will proceed rain or shine, with contingency plans in place should inclement weather arise.
